So looking at Princeton, for example, 25% of students achieved an SAT score lower than 1380, and 25% of students achieved an SAT score higher than 1540 – this means that 50% of the students at Princeton score between 1380 and 1540 on the SAT. 4. Students involved in drama performance scored an average of 65.5 points higher on the verbal component and 35.5 points higher in the math component of the SAT; Students who took courses in drama study or appreciation scored, on average, 55 points higher on verbal and 26 points higher on math than their non-arts classmates. In general, a score a little below a school's 25th percentile SAT score (think 10 points) is the lowest score you could get and reasonably expect to have any sort of chance at admission—and even with other strong parts in your application, that score would make the school a reach for you. Students overestimated their actual SAT scores by an average of 25 points (SD = 81, d = 0.31), with 10% under-reporting, 51% reporting accurately, and 39% over-reporting, indicating a systematic bias towards over-reporting.
